Transaction e69670b17ccde2765263585cddbd3e65a2c20987c1c027e7b4ba398a206d42dd
1 Input
1 Output
-
e69670b17ccde2765263585cddbd3e65a2c20987c1c027e7b4ba398a206d42dd:0
- value
- 343809
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5703024bdb30660a9ff35406b67a961f5fc733cd OP_EQUAL
- address
- 39d6KJM7cDeXT7xcaMoFDL5MQfuoHyPPAw